Goretex and other breathable waterproof fabrics. So much better than sweaty plastic for outdoor activities! I remember the early cagoules of the 70s and yes, they kept the rain out but they were so clammy to wear.

Viscose rayon...this has been around for nearly a century, but it's pretty much the only artificial fabric I enjoy wearing in dresses, skirts, shirts etc. I know it's made from cellulose, so you could argue it's slightly 'natural', but I think the manufacturing process is far from organic, unfortunately!
